A038299 Triangle whose (i,j)-th entry is binomial(i,j)*9^(i-j)*9^j. 2

%I #7 Mar 30 2012 17:38:34

%S 1,9,9,81,162,81,729,2187,2187,729,6561,26244,39366,26244,6561,59049,

%T 295245,590490,590490,295245,59049,531441,3188646,7971615,10628820,

%U 7971615,3188646,531441,4782969,33480783,100442349,167403915

%N Triangle whose (i,j)-th entry is binomial(i,j)*9^(i-j)*9^j.

%D B. N. Cyvin et al., Isomer enumeration of unbranched catacondensed polygonal systems with pentagons and heptagons, Match, No. 34 (Oct 1996), pp. 109-121.

%F Row sums: sum_{j=0..i} T(i,j) = A001027(i). [From _R. J. Mathar_, Mar 30 2009]

%K nonn,tabl,easy

%O 0,2

%A _N. J. A. Sloane_.
